John Theodore Gansert 1940 - 1982

John Theodore Gansert was born on January 11, 1940, and died at age 42 years old on April 18, 1982. John Gansert was buried at Jefferson Barracks National Cemetery Section S Site 458 2900 Sheridan Road, in St. Louis, Mo. In 1940, in the year that John Theodore Gansert was born, on July 27th, the cartoon character Bugs Bunny debuted in his first film A Wild Hare - voiced by Mel Blanc. He has since appeared in more short films, feature films, compilations, TV series, music records, comic books, video games, award shows, amusement park rides, and commercials than any other cartoon character. He even has a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ame. "What's up, Doc?"
